Troubleshooting Questions and Answers:

1. Question: Why is there no sound coming from my device?
Answer: To resolve this issue, ensure that the audio driver is correctly installed and up to date. You can check this by going to Device Manager, locating the audio driver under Sound, Video, and Game Controllers, and updating or reinstalling the driver if necessary. Also, check the volume settings and make sure they are not muted or set too low.

2. Question: I cannot hear any audio during video calls. What should I do?
Answer: If you are experiencing audio issues specifically during video calls, firstly check if the microphone is not muted or blocked. Adjust the microphone settings in the application you are using for video calls and ensure the correct microphone device is selected. Additionally, try updating the audio driver and check if the issue is resolved.

3. Question: Why is the audio quality distorted or crackling on my device?
Answer: If you are experiencing distorted or crackling audio, it might be due to outdated or incompatible audio drivers. Update the Realtek audio driver for your device by visiting the official Hp support website or using a reliable driver update tool. Also, make sure the speakers or headphones are properly connected and not damaged. Adjusting the audio settings to optimize sound quality can also help alleviate the issue.
